diff --git a/PUB/PBO/MyHome.aspx b/PUB/PBO/MyHome.aspx index 6ced53c..c916345 100644 --- a/PUB/PBO/MyHome.aspx +++ b/PUB/PBO/MyHome.aspx @@ -1,5 +1,33 @@ <%@ Page Title="" Language="C#" MasterPageFile="~/SitePBO.master" AutoEventWireup="true" CodeBehind="MyHome.aspx.cs" Inherits="PUB.PBO.MyHome" %> + +<%@ Register Src="~/WebUserContols/mod_authError.ascx" TagPrefix="uc1" TagName="mod_authError" %> + +
+
+
+

Amministratori

+
+
+

Condomini

+
+
+

Aree Intervento

+
+
+

Fornitori

+
+
+

Utenti

+
+
+ +

Condomini - Fornitori

+
+
+
+
+ +
diff --git a/PUB/PBO/MyHome.aspx.cs b/PUB/PBO/MyHome.aspx.cs index 7438527..ba86a41 100644 --- a/PUB/PBO/MyHome.aspx.cs +++ b/PUB/PBO/MyHome.aspx.cs @@ -1,9 +1,5 @@ -using System; -using System.Collections.Generic; -using System.Linq; -using System.Web; -using System.Web.UI; -using System.Web.UI.WebControls; +using SteamWare; +using System; namespace PUB.PBO { @@ -11,7 +7,9 @@ namespace PUB.PBO { protected void Page_Load(object sender, EventArgs e) { - + bool userAuth = devicesAuthProxy.stObj.userHasRight("PBO"); + divButtons.Visible = userAuth; + divAuthError.Visible = !userAuth; } } } \ No newline at end of file diff --git a/PUB/PBO/MyHome.aspx.designer.cs b/PUB/PBO/MyHome.aspx.designer.cs index 3d3b462..ea9f022 100644 --- a/PUB/PBO/MyHome.aspx.designer.cs +++ b/PUB/PBO/MyHome.aspx.designer.cs @@ -1,17 +1,96 @@ //------------------------------------------------------------------------------ -// +// // Codice generato da uno strumento. // // Le modifiche a questo file possono causare un comportamento non corretto e verranno perse se -// il codice viene rigenerato. -// +// il codice viene rigenerato. +// //------------------------------------------------------------------------------ -namespace PUB.PBO -{ - - - public partial class MyHome - { - } +namespace PUB.PBO { + + + public partial class MyHome { + + /// + /// Controllo divButtons. + /// + /// + /// Campo generato automaticamente. + /// Per la modifica, spostare la dichiarazione di campo dal file di progettazione al file code-behind. + /// + protected global::System.Web.UI.HtmlControls.HtmlGenericControl divButtons; + + /// + /// Controllo hlAnagAmmin. + /// + /// + /// Campo generato automaticamente. + /// Per la modifica, spostare la dichiarazione di campo dal file di progettazione al file code-behind. + /// + protected global::System.Web.UI.WebControls.HyperLink hlAnagAmmin; + + /// + /// Controllo hlAnagCondomini. + /// + /// + /// Campo generato automaticamente. + /// Per la modifica, spostare la dichiarazione di campo dal file di progettazione al file code-behind. + /// + protected global::System.Web.UI.WebControls.HyperLink hlAnagCondomini; + + /// + /// Controllo hlSegnalatori. + /// + /// + /// Campo generato automaticamente. + /// Per la modifica, spostare la dichiarazione di campo dal file di progettazione al file code-behind. + /// + protected global::System.Web.UI.WebControls.HyperLink hlSegnalatori; + + /// + /// Controllo hlUtenti. + /// + /// + /// Campo generato automaticamente. + /// Per la modifica, spostare la dichiarazione di campo dal file di progettazione al file code-behind. + /// + protected global::System.Web.UI.WebControls.HyperLink hlUtenti; + + /// + /// Controllo HyperLink1. + /// + /// + /// Campo generato automaticamente. + /// Per la modifica, spostare la dichiarazione di campo dal file di progettazione al file code-behind. + /// + protected global::System.Web.UI.WebControls.HyperLink HyperLink1; + + /// + /// Controllo hlForn2Cond. + /// + /// + /// Campo generato automaticamente. + /// Per la modifica, spostare la dichiarazione di campo dal file di progettazione al file code-behind. + /// + protected global::System.Web.UI.WebControls.HyperLink hlForn2Cond; + + /// + /// Controllo divAuthError. + /// + /// + /// Campo generato automaticamente. + /// Per la modifica, spostare la dichiarazione di campo dal file di progettazione al file code-behind. + /// + protected global::System.Web.UI.HtmlControls.HtmlGenericControl divAuthError; + + /// + /// Controllo mod_authError. + /// + /// + /// Campo generato automaticamente. + /// Per la modifica, spostare la dichiarazione di campo dal file di progettazione al file code-behind. + /// + protected global::PUB.WebUserContols.mod_authError mod_authError; + } }